About Stephanie

Stephanie Birmingham is a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C) practicing in Wisconsin with five years of clinical experience. She focuses on helping people navigate stress, anxiety, depression, low self-esteem, relationship and family concerns, addiction, grief, trauma and abuse, and other life transitions. Her work also includes support for LGBT clients, first responders, caregivers, and individuals coping with chronic illness, disability, or isolation.

Stephanie has experience working in corrections with justice-involved persons, bringing an understanding of the unique challenges that setting can present. She emphasizes practical strategies and goal-oriented work, using approaches such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y to help clients identify unhelpful patterns and build skills for change. Stephanie aims to create an open, nonjudgmental space where thoughts and feelings can be explored honestly and respectfully.

Clients are supported and empowered to take steps toward a more fulfilling life, whether they need tools for coping with day-to-day stressors, help addressing substance use, or assistance processing grief and trauma. Stephanie collaborates with each person to tailor care to their needs and values. Please note she is not accepting new clients at this time.

CBT-Focused Online Support and Flexible Care

Stephanie uses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) to help clients identify and shift unhelpful thoughts and behaviors. CBT is a skills-based approach that breaks problems into manageable parts and teaches practical tools for managing anxiety, low mood, and stress, as well as patterns that contribute to relationship or substance use concerns.

Finding the right approach is a collaborative process. Stephanie works with each person to learn about their needs, goals, and preferences, and adjusts techniques to fit what feels most useful. Together they explore strategies, track progress, and refine the plan so therapy stays relevant and effective.
